Book Description
The shoreline between California's Golden Gate and the Oregon border offers an endless variety of coastal attractions: soft white sand and coarse pebble beaches, forests of Sitka spruce and fields of California poppies, redwood glades and crashing surf, lighthouses and whales. This easy-to-use, up-to-date, comprehensive guidebook, packed with information on every page, tells you where to go in coastal northern California, how to get there, what facilities to expect, and what you can do at each location. The guide's gorgeous color photographs, topographical maps, and abundant information on natural history and the environment make it the perfect guide to pack along on any excursion to the coast of northern California for hikers, picnickers, campers, surfers, divers, wheelchair users, birders, boaters, kayakers, anglers, and travelers.
Includes a comprehensive list of more than 300 beaches, parks on or near the coast, and paths to the shoreline
Features more than 300 full-color photographs, 49 detailed maps, and charts that provide information on facilities, attractions, coastal environments, access for the disabled, and more
Lists recreational outfitters, including fishing boat services, kayak and surfboard rentals, and riding stables
Gives information on hostels; campgrounds in national, state, and local parks; and private campground facilities
Introduces the coast's major environments, including beaches, rocky shoreline, and the redwood forest, and highlights the plants, animals, and birds that can be seen in each

An Overview of North Coast Travel Opportunities.......2007-05-30
North of the Golden Gate Bridge, the California Coast becomes much more rural and rugged. Many state parks, beaches, tourist towns, and rivers invite exploration, but there is so much out there it is hard to know where to begin. Enter the California Coastal Commision which has somehow strong-armed the University of California Press into printing a guidebook listing all parks, beaches, public access points, private nature preserves, hostels, and many whale watching tours. (When was the last time a major university press published a travel guide?) If you are unsure where to go, this book is a good place to look for ideas.
On the whole, this is a decent book. Every park, tourist center, or beach has a one to three paragraph description focusing on the basics: fees, directions, natural features and the like. Destinations are listed from north to south with facing maps showing their location. The book is further divided into six major chapters: one for each county north of San Francisco. Interspersed throughout the text are feature articles covering everything from techtonic plates to birding and common coastal flowers. The color photos are stunning, but don't expect that much blue sky on your vacation. The north coast receives a lot of rain.
My main concern with the book is that park descriptions are sometimes too brief. In some ways, this is an unfair criticism because comprehensive guides cannot get bogged down in details. Still, I thought hiking was definitely shorted in this book. Day hikers will want to supplement it with John McKinney's California's Coastal Parks: A Day Hiker's Guide. If you want to spend several days, or weeks, exploring the wilder sections of the coast on foot, consider getting Bob Lorentzen and Richard Nichols Hiking the California Coastal Trail, Volume 1: Oregon to Monterey. State parks also often publish their own literature and maps. That said, this book is a valuable resource for planning your north coast vacation. Book Description
World War I conjures up visions of barbed wire, trenches, mud and massive and futile offensives with horrendous casualties. The frustrating stalemate on the western front with its unprecedented casualties provoked a furious debate in London between the civil and military authorities over the best way to defeat Germany. The passions aroused continued to the present day. The mercurial and dynamic David Lloyd George stood at the centre of this controversy throughout the war. His intervention in military questions and determination to redirect strategy put him at odds with the leading soldiers and admirals of his day.
David Woodward, a student of the Great War for some four decades, explores the at times Byzantine atmosphere at Whitehall by exhaustive archival research in official and private papers. The focus is on Lloyd George and his adversaries such as Lord Kitchener, General Sir William Robertson, and Field Marshall Sir Douglas Haig. But the result is a fresh, compelling and detailed account of the interaction between civil and military authorities in total war.

Book Description
A history of contemporary rhetoric, Visions and Revisions: Continuity and Change in Rhetoric and Composition examines the discipline’s emergence and development from the rise of new rhetoric in the late 1960s through the present. Editor James D. Williams has assembled nine essays from leading scholars to trace the origins of new rhetoric and examine current applications of genre studies, the rhetoric of science, the rhetoric of information, and the influence of liberal democracy on rhetoric in society.
Given the field’s diversity, a historical sketch cannot adopt a single perspective. Part one of Visions and Revisions therefore offers the detailed reminiscences of four pioneers in new rhetoric, while the essays in part two reflect on a variety of issues that have influenced (and continue to influence) current theory and practice. In light of the recent shift in focus of scholarly investigation toward theory, Williams’s collection contextualizes the underlying tension between theory and practice while stressing instruction of students as the most important dimension of rhetoric and composition today. Together, these chapters from some of the most influential scholars in the field provide a range of perspectives on the state of rhetoric and composition and illuminate the discipline’s development over the course of the last forty years.

Book Description
This ground-breaking book probes the way that two capitalist superpowers, Great Britain and the United States, responded to the momentous challenge of revolution that emerged during the early years of this century. Focusing on two key figures--Woodrow Wilson and David Lloyd George--the book explores the collective impact on the Western democracies of the revolutions that swept Mexico in 1910, China in 1911, and, especially, Russia in 1917.

A Flawed book with a Misleading title.......2005-04-26
Lloyd C. Gardner's Safe for Democracy: The Anglo-American Response to Revolution, 1911-1923 looks on the surface to be a discussion of the rapproachment of the two English-speaking Powers in the 1910s-1920s, focusing on Woodrow Wilson and David Lloyd George, but Gardner manages to miss the book on both counts because (1) Wilson and George only worked on 2 of the 4 revolutions Gardner recounts (Germany and Russia, with China and Mexico being ourside their respoective realms), and (2) The other problem is that Gardner never really shows any Anglo-American Cooperation. In fact, all he shows is Anglo-American sntagonism, from rebuffing British interests in Mexico to Wilson's furor over George's attempt to normalise relations with the Soviets. Only after the Washington Treaty did Anglo-American relations get any better.
To go along with Mr. Obert's review, the lack of domestic coverage as well as the poor readability of the work really doom it. Knock's To End All Wars is truly a better work and will easily recommend it over Safe for Democracy

Book Description
This second edition of
Plant Drug Analysis includes more than 200 updated color photographs of superb quality demonstrating chromatograms of all relevant standard drugs. The atlas will be a useful reference for analyzing plant drugs, identifying unknown drugs or monitoring the purity or constituents of a given drug.
All drugs presented meet the standard of the official pharmacopoeia and originate from well-defined botanical sources. With this guide the technique of thin layer chromatography can be easily used without previous pharmacognostic training. Only commercially available equipment and reagents are needed, the sources as well as all practical details are given.

Book Description
Multiresolution methods in geometric modelling are concerned with the generation, representation, and manipulation of geometric objects at several levels of detail. Applications include fast visualization and rendering as well as coding, compression, and digital transmission of 3D geometric objects.
This book marks the culmination of the four-year EU-funded research project, Multiresolution in Geometric Modelling (MINGLE). The book contains seven survey papers, providing a detailed overview of recent advances in the various fields within multiresolution modelling, and sixteen additional research papers. Each of the seven parts of the book starts with a survey paper, followed by the associated research papers in that area. All papers were originally presented at the MINGLE 2003 workshop held at Emmanuel College, Cambridge, UK, 9-11 September 2003.
Book Description
The classic poems and spine–tingling stories of a Gothic American master collected in one volume.
Of all the American masters, Edgar Allan Poe staked out perhaps the most unique and vivid reputation, as a master of the macabre. Even today, in the age of horror movies and high–tech haunted houses, Poe is the first choice of entertainment for many who want a spine–chilling thrill.
Born in Boston in 1809, and dead at the age of 40, Poe wrote across several fields during his life, noted for his poetry and short stories as well as his criticism. The best of each of these is collected here, including the classic poem The Raven, and timeless stories like The Tell–Tale Heart. In his introduction to this volume, G. R. Thompson argues that Poe was a great satirist and comedic craftsman, as well as a formidable Gothic writer. "All of Poe's fiction," Thompson writes, "and the poems as well, can be seen as one coherent piece – as the work of one of the greatest ironists of world literature."
